Installation

Double-glazed windows are highly efficient and can save energy, but they can be prone to developing fog or condensation between the panes. This can be a hassle but it can also increase heating and cooling costs. If this happens, it is crucial to have the window repaired by a professional as soon as possible to avoid further damage.

Window specialists can repair existing windows and provide upgraded glass options to increase efficiency, curb appeal and security. Options include windows with insulated glass units window films, low-emissivity glass that can reduce air leakage and energy transfer. These improvements can reduce the cost of cooling and heating as well as eliminate drafts, cut down on noise and improve the overall appearance of a home.

Tinted windows can be upgraded for security aesthetics, comfort, and security. They will guard against UV rays and increase insulation. They also improve privacy. These tints can be applied by experts to both new and existing windows and doors. They can also apply a hydrophobic coating, a surface protectant that blocks dust, water pollen, pollutants, and mineral deposits to facilitate cleaning and a longer life.

Draughts and leaking windows can be annoying but they could also cause structural damage to your home. Window specialists can identify the source of the leak and repair it, avoiding the expense of a complete replacement.

The wood stops (or trim) that hold windows from the past in place are often cracked or painted over, which causes the frames to loosen. They can be taken off and replaced by a professional and they can be painted or caulked to give a fresh appearance to any room.

If a window is hard to open or close, there may be an issue with the locking mechanism or hinge. Experts can evaluate your window and provide you with a free quote without any obligation. They can also replace the doorknob or lock to make your windows more secure.
